Our willingness to compromise the Word makes us easily seduced.

Now when we get into this confusion is because we want to satisfy our own ego and other people instead of Jesus. In this process, the Spirit will withdraw Himself, and we are going in the flesh when we try to exercise and perform already supplied Spiritual gifts in our service.

In this state we do not walk by the Spirit, and we will get condemnation. We ignore that because we believe that we are in Christ (operate in Christ), and therefore no condemnation. So the condemnation we will get we believe are attacks from satan and we just walks on and things are getting worse and worse.

No one who is willing to compromise on the word will get some revelation of the Word. When we are all more or less willing to compromise the Word, we understand more the condition of the church.

Unfortunately, this is most prevalent in the so-called "prophetic" service. We are more than willing to give people "good future prospects" than rebuke from the Lord for unwillingness to repent from sin.

When we, on top of this, does not have anyone to relate to, the errors accelerate and we soon find ourselves in a state of a lot of errors. This is hard to get out of if we do not realize that we always must be humble. All of us are more or less caught in this trick of the devil.

If we are humble and realize our pride so that the Holy Spirit will judge us for our mistakes, we will get back on track. However, if we keep up being proud we are caught in a lot of small mistakes that can, over time, lead to destruction.

The best way to get out of this is to always have someone to relate to. Some brothers who are more than willing to correct you if you make mistakes.

Unfortunately they are few.
